Tracing Intricacies

20.03.24 — 06.04.24

Wellington selling exhibition featuring artists Kate van der Drift, Connah Podmore, Karen Rubado, and Helen Reynolds.


 

Tracing Intricacies brings together four artists who use different mediums to visualise the fleeting and invisible. Kate van der Drift’s work captures the life and pollutants of Piako River, Karen Rubado’s loom work reflects the delicate balance between form and potential collapse, Connah Podmore’s charcoal drawings showcase the beauty and complexity of domestic space and motherhood, and Helen Reynolds’ paintings explore the repetition of a serpentine line to build focus and scale. From the large and immersive to the small and intimate, each work provides a unique way to experience the familiar materials and line of enquiry which draws these artists back time and again .
